First Steps and a Lot of Scrolling
First, I just started Googling, you know, “Jersey Shore rentals pet friendly.” A bunch of stuff popped up, some of the big-name rental sites. I spent, like, hours scrolling through listings. I got pretty good at spotting the “Pets Allowed” section, usually way down at the bottom in the fine print.

It was a mixed bag. Some places were super clear – “Yes, we love dogs!” Others were more vague, like “Pets considered.” What does that even mean? I ended up making a list of potential places, noting down which ones seemed promising and which ones were a definite no.
Digging Deeper and Asking Questions
After I had my shortlist, I started, doing more detailed research on the places. I wanted to read reviews, see if anyone mentioned bringing their pets, and get a feel for the neighborhood. Were there dog parks nearby? Dog-friendly beaches? That kind of stuff.
Then came the emails and phone calls. “Hi, I’m interested in your rental. I saw it’s pet-friendly, but I wanted to confirm. We have a well-behaved golden retriever. Are there any size restrictions or extra fees?” Some places had weight limits, some had extra “pet fees” (which, okay, I get it), and some were totally cool with it. I made sure to be upfront and honest about Buster’s size and breed – no surprises!
- Made a spreadsheet to list the houses
- Detailed the pet policy on each rental
- Made notes of the extra costs
Narrowing It Down and Making a Choice
After all that, I narrowed it down to a few top contenders. We looked at pictures again, read more reviews, and finally picked one that seemed perfect. It had a fenced-in yard (huge plus!), was close to a dog-friendly beach, and the owners seemed really nice and welcoming.
